From: Danny Auble <[email protected]> To: "slurm-dev" <[email protected]>, Date: 08/05/2013 05:14 PM Subject: [slurm-dev] Re: InfinibandOFEDFrequency parse error in acct_gather.conf The acct_gather.conf file requires the related plugin to be loaded for options to be valid or not. Odds are you don't have AcctGatherInfinbandType=acct_gather_infiniband/ofed in your slurm.conf file. I'll update the documents to attempt to make this more clear. Danny On 08/02/13 23:10, Jonathan Mills wrote: > Apparently, in SLURM 2.6.0, the keyword 'InfinibandOFEDFrequency' is no longer a recognized key in acct_gather.conf. It kills slurmd if you try: > > > [2013-08-03T02:05:39.706] debug2: Reading acct_gather.conf file /etc/slurm/acct_gather.conf > [2013-08-03T02:05:39.706] error: Parsing error at unrecognized key: InfinibandOFEDFrequency > [2013-08-03T02:05:39.706] error: Parse error in file /etc/slurm/acct_gather.conf line 6: "InfinibandOFEDFrequency=4" > > > Here's my full acct_gather.conf: > > ### > # Slurm acct_gather configuration file > ### > > # Parameters for AcctGatherInfiniband/ofed plugin > InfinibandOFEDFrequency=4 > InfinibandOFEDPort=1 > > > ....it's copied straight from the documentation here: > > http://slurm.schedmd.com/acct_gather.conf.html=
